ATTEMPTED SUICIDE. CHRISTCHURCH, July 13. David Thomas Borcoski pleaded guilty in tho Magistrate’s Court this morning to attempting to commit suicide. Borcoski, who was homeless, had been given a night’s lodging by a farmer on July 4, and next- morning was found with his throat cut, but not dangerously. lie was convicted and ordered to conic up for sentence if called on in six months.
